Photo of Michael NoonanMichael Noonan (Limerick City, Fine Gael)

It is an evolving situation. This is a significant first step in what we think will be a significant approach to the provision of infrastructure and the creation of jobs. As I said in my reply, the NPRF will come back to me shortly with proposals for the establishment of the strategic investment fund. My understanding of the nature of the fund is that people will apply to it. Entrepreneurs will apply to the fund. Like any investment bank there will be an assessment of their proposal and business plan and they will get an advance of venture capital on that basis.
